October 15, 1928 - May 7, 2013

W. J. ''Bud'' Bell, 84, of Osceola, Arkansas entered into rest May 7, 2013. He was born October 15, 1928 to Walter James and Annie Chambers Bell in Bay, Arkansas. He was a member of Luxora Church of Christ, retired from American Greetings in Osceola and an Army Veteran. He is survived by his wife of 61 years, Jewell Kincaid Bell; two sons: Barry (Carla) Bell of Luxora and Bruce (Vickie) Bell of Bartlett, Tennessee; five grandchildren: Nathan Bell, Natalie Bell Mosley, Nicholas Bell, Tyler Bell and Briah Bell; six great-grandchild: Ethan Pená, Briley Pená, Lucy Mosley, Emmett Mosley, Scarlett Bell, and Kye Shannon. He is preceded in death by his parents, four sisters and one brother.
